#1c3ee2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c3ee2 is composed of 11% red, 24.3%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 72.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 229.7 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 49.8%. #1c3ee2 color hex could be obtained by blending #387cff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#1c3ee2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020511 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c3ee2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7e80 is the less saturated color, while #0831f6 is the most saturated one.
